Text
I.Notwithstanding the provisions of RSA 9:17, no transfer shall be made from any appropriation items for permanent personal services to any other use or purpose, provided however that this provision shall not supersede the provisions of RSA 99:4.
II.The provisions of this section shall apply to transfers in general appropriations, capital budget appropriations and in any other special appropriations.
[Paragraph III effective until June 30, 2027.]
III.The department of health and human services may be exempt from the limitations set forth in paragraph I, subject to approval by the fiscal committee of the general court of any transfer of appropriations from permanent personal services to any other use or purpose.

Legislative History
1967, 292:1. 1969, 367:6. 1974, 40:75. 1977, 600:50. 1985, 399:3, I. 2008, 177:13, eff. June 11, 2008. 2017, 156:204, eff. July 1, 2017.
